Experience the Divine: Ganga Aarti at Dashashwamedh Ghat

If you’re in Varanasi, one of the must-see spectacles is the enchanting Ganga Aarti held every evening at Dashashwamedh Ghat. This mesmerizing ritual is more than just a ceremony; it’s a heartfelt expression of devotion that celebrates the sacredness of the Ganges River. As the sun sets and the twilight envelops the city, crowds gather along the banks, creating an atmosphere filled with reverence and joy. During the Ganga Aarti, the ebb of the mighty Ganga merges beautifully with the rhythmic beats of drums and the melodious chants of mantras. Flickering flames from the Aarti lamps illuminate the faces of devotees and visitors alike, creating a scene that's as picturesque as it is spiritually uplifting.
